Commenting on the announcement of a consultation from the DWP ‘Small pots: a pathway for consolidation”, Hannah English, Head of DC Corporate Consulting, Hymans Robertson says:

“We welcome today’s consultation from the DWP “Small pots: a pathway for consolidation” with a clear focus on how to help reduce some of the impacts of low pension engagement. This consultation, combined with a drive towards dashboards, will help remove some current inertia resulting in better engagement, better understanding, and ultimately better retirement options for many.

“As the labour market has significantly changed in the last decade, so too should pensions. Individuals move jobs on a more frequent basis, with likely multiple employers in their lifetime and corresponding pots. While there is a growing focus on pensions adequacy, it is important that this looks beyond just current employees and considers past employees to ensure that deferred members remain front of mind too. At a time when pensions adequacy has never been more prominent an issue for both employers and for individuals all pension savings must work harder than ever - employees can’t afford to see their small pots forgotten.”
